I am assuming you have a DTXPRESSII. I believe (from memory) there  are
three volume knobs on the front of the DtxpressII, overall volume out, click
volume, song volume and aux input volume.  The song volume is adjusted by
the "Accomp Vol" knob on the front of the module. This will
increase/decrease volume of song you are playing too. The choke function is
only available on zones 2, 6 & 7 and you must use a stereo cable to connect
the pad and the pad type needs to be set for a PCY65S and not the PCY65.
Ditto, what Ed said about the "live" and "practice" mode.

> Dumb answers are what you've gotta watch out for. Here comes one 
> now, I think. First of all, you can't adjust the relative balance of 
> song and drums inside the brain, except incidentally by fiddling 
> with the volume of individual triggers in the voice menu or the 
> volume of the entire kit in the utility menu. The reason why you can 
> only affect the snare and kick via the knobs on the front panel now 
> is that you probably have the utility menu's volume control mode set 
> to "live" instead of "practice." If you switch the setting, the 
> accomp knob will take care of the song level and the click knob, 
> the . . . click level. Pressing the shift button while turning those 
> knobs in the practice setting will get you the snare and kick, 
> respectively. By the way, the aux volume knob controls the volume of 
> only an external device connected via aux input beside it. You can 
> find the explanation in the manual somewhere in the "About the Song" 
> section. Let us know if that isn't the problem.
> 
> On the choke function, the parameter "pad type" in the trigger menu 
> determines what kind of response you'll get from individual 
> triggers. You might have accidentally set the pad type for the 
> cymbal in question incorrectly, resulting in the loss of the choke 
> function. I forget which type disables the choke, but it shouldn't 
> take long finding out.
